The Role of Randomness and Probability

At its heart, plinko is governed by probability. Each peg interaction represents a branching point, with the disc having roughly a 50/50 chance of deflecting left or right. While this sounds straightforward, the cumulative effect of numerous deflections creates a complex probabilistic landscape. The further the disc travels, the more unpredictable its path becomes. This is why predicting the final outcome with certainty is virtually impossible; it’s a demonstration of the butterfly effect in action. Despite the randomness, the overall statistical distribution of outcomes tends to follow a normal distribution, meaning most discs will land near the center, with fewer landing on the extreme ends. This principle is leveraged by game designers to balance risk and reward effectively.

The Evolution of Plinko: From Game Show to Online Casino

The origins of plinko trace back to the iconic “Price is Right” game show, where contestants would drop chips down a pegboard for a chance to win cash and prizes. This format quickly captured the imagination of viewers, and the game’s simple yet captivating gameplay proved remarkably enduring. Over time, plinko evolved beyond the confines of television studios, finding its way into physical arcades and amusement parks. These early iterations often featured larger boards and more elaborate prize structures, contributing to the game’s growing popularity. The transition to the digital realm marked a significant turning point, allowing plinko to reach a global audience and introducing new levels of innovation.

The Role of Near Misses and Variable Ratio Reinforcement

Another key element in plinko’s addictive quality is the phenomenon of “near misses.” When the disc lands just short of a high-value prize slot, it triggers a similar brain response as a win, creating a sense of close call that encourages continued play. This contributes to a phenomenon known as variable ratio reinforcement, where rewards are delivered unpredictably. This pattern is particularly effective at maintaining engagement, as players believe the next drop could be the one that yields a significant payout. Casinos and game developers often utilize variable ratio reinforcement to maximize player retention. The combination of visual stimulation, perceived control, near misses, and variable rewards makes plinko a highly compelling—and potentially addictive—form of entertainment.
